My 83 year old Dad's favorite place and he is extremely picky. He hates most restaurant food.
We get there when they open to shorten the wait times which can be a little long for the food. Check their hours and days open before driving over. We don't mind waiting to get freshly cooked food.
Today we had chicken tenders, crab cakes, baked potatoes, fried okra and coleslaw. All delicious. Their tartar sauce is yummy. Their desserts are also beautiful and delicious but you won't have room for it!
The meals sometimes come in different sizes. I learned not to order the biggest portion because there's no way to eat it all. I judged which size by the price. I had no idea that a $7.95 crab cake meal would be plenty of food. It had 2 cakes, coleslaw, 3 circular hush puppies that I thought were onion rings at first, and my choice of side which was okra today.
I never would have gone here on my own not being big on seafood but they have the best chicken tenders around. So try it if you aren't in a hurry. -

Stopped by for lunch. Clean and inviting restaurant. Good menu with an extensive range of options. The lunch menu has a fairly large amount of choices for under $10. I got the super combo. It came with a ton of fried shrimp, a large deviled crab, two chicken fingers, three hush puppies, coleslaw and choice of a side. I got cheese grits. All for $8.95. It was a large portion so I ended up leaving with a to-go box. It tasted good too. I'll definitely put this in my rotation.
